This is an interesting difference to bring up. I would trace the push for high graduation rates in the US to its inclusion as a parameter in the canonical US News college ranking equations. The oft-stated reasoning is that a top-flight college that allows even 10% of its students to leave without a degree in 5-years is failing them somehow.

To some extent, this is true -- I have personally seen brilliant friends drop out of a stressful college when clearly the university was not serving their reasonable needs.
